Definition : Agile enterprise

An agile enterprise is a business or organization that is able to quickly and efficiently adapt to changing market conditions, customer needs, and technological advancements. It is characterized by a flexible and dynamic approach to decision-making, resource allocation, and project management, allowing it to stay ahead of the competition and continuously improve its processes and products. An agile enterprise values collaboration, innovation, and continuous learning, and embraces a culture of adaptability and resilience. By leveraging agile principles and methodologies, an agile enterprise is able to achieve greater efficiency, productivity, and customer satisfaction, ultimately leading to long-term success and growth.
